Honoring Our Volunteers

by Gloria Huang November 1, 2010November 1, 2010

At the Red Cross, volunteers are the steam that keeps our humanitarian service engine running. From our Hometown Heroes programs carried out by the chapters, to our most prestigious national volunteer awards, we try to recognize their efforts and immeasurable contribution to our work.

Earthquake in Haiti

by Wendy Harman January 12, 2010January 15, 2010

Our thoughts and support are with Haiti. We have pledged an initial $2oo,ooo and are accepting donations to the International Response Fund.
